I have recovered from bulimia. It is very hard but not impossible. For me, it helped to realize that it was a symptom of my PTSD - a coping mechanism. It might also help to try a "harm reduction" approach rather than full abstinence to start. And it might help to realize that there will be times (and it sounds like this is one of them), where you just need to sit on the floor and say "this sucks...I quit"...then you get back up and get back at it.
